Dear Mosaic Supporters:
It is with great regret that we must inform you that Mosaic 2008 will not be taking place this year.
Unfortunately, Central Memorial Park -- the traditional site of Mosaic -- was not available to us this year due to construction in the park. While we extensively explored alternate locations to hold Mosaic 2008, we were unable to secure a suitable site.
We would like to thank you for your past support of Mosaic, and we look forward to resuming the festival next year. Please check back here for updates and information regarding Mosaic 2009 early next year.

The Mosaic Cultural Festival is an event that celebrates Calgary's
urban community and the diversity and creativity that is alive
within it. Mosaic is open to the public
and admission is free!
Come join us to check out all the exciting activities Mosaic
has to offer:
- Two performance stages featuring music and dance artists
representing many different cultures,
- Exhibitors & vendors consisting of cultural
associations, community and non-profit groups, artisans
and other vendors,
- A beer garden
- An assortment of food vendors selling various ethnic delicacies,
- A free draw - enter to win great prizes from our sponsors,
- A cultural craft centre where guests learn to make an
ethnic craft for themselves,
- A children's area with games, face painting and other
fun activities, and
- Buskers around the park entertaining mini audiences of
their own.
